A new book recently caught my attention written by Gloria Safar, a triathlete herself and motivational coach, called Triathlon for Girls Like Us.  It discussed how to properly train for the big day, proper nutrition for training, how to avoid injury and has a training log so you can track your personal goals.  It's very motivational and has everything included to help women adapt to training for their first triathlon.  If you have enough courage, I suggest you check it out on Amazon.
